Apple is planning to use its own C2 cellular modem in the iPhone 18 Pro, moving away from Qualcomm-supplied components [1].
This shift represents a major strategic pivot for the company. By developing its own silicon for cellular connectivity, Apple can reduce its long-term reliance on external suppliers and gain tighter control over the hardware-software integration of its mobile devices [1], [3].
Reports published this week indicate that the C2 modem is designed to improve overall performance and lower production costs [1], [3]. The transition follows years of effort by Apple to internalize core technologies that were previously sourced from third-party vendors. While the company has successfully transitioned to its own processors and GPUs, the cellular modem has remained a complex hurdle due to the intricacies of global network standards.
The iPhone 18 Pro is expected to launch later this year [1], [3]. According to reports from July 30, 2026 [1] and July 31, 2026 [3], the integration of the C2 modem could signal a broader strategy to phase out Qualcomm modems across the iPhone lineup over time. This move would mirror the company's approach with the M-series chips used in Mac computers.
Industry analysts said that moving to an in-house solution allows Apple to optimize power efficiency and signal strength specifically for its own operating system. Such integration often leads to better battery life, and more consistent connectivity in low-signal areas. However, the success of the C2 modem depends on its ability to maintain compatibility across diverse global carriers and frequency bands [2].
Apple has not officially confirmed the specifications of the iPhone 18 Pro. The company typically reserves detailed hardware disclosures for its annual autumn product events, where the new device is expected to be unveiled alongside other updates to the mobile ecosystem [3].
